Fulham 2 Newcastle 1

Fulham returned to winning ways against a Newcastle side, last night, that are a far cry from the top-four pushing side of last season.

With over 25,000 packed into our grand stadium, Fulham got off to the better start with Newcastle struggling to get into the match. Just before the 20 minute mark, Fulham went ahead, although there was a touch of fortune about the goal with Sidwell`s shot taking a deflection off of Williamson to beat Kruk.

However, Newcastle, in the second half, got back into the match when Ben Arta scored a fine equalizer. His shot, from some twenty-five yards out, totally deceived Schwarzer to go into the goal just under the bar.

Thankfully, Fulham`s heads didn`t drop and when the former Newcastle player, Damien Duff, curled in a cross in the 63rd minute, Hugo Rodallega was on hand to head home the winner.

The win lifts Fulham into 13th place in the Premier League although the winning margin could have been a lot greater with Berbatov being denied twice when one-on-one with Krul, although Newcastle may well point to two goal line clearances from Riether that denied them further goals.

All in all it was an entertaining evening down at Craven Cottage.
